Establishing reference intervals for D-dimer to trimesters.
Şerif Ercan1, Sadullah Özkan, Nihal Yücel
1Department of Clinical Biochemistry, Lüleburgaz State Hospital , Kırklareli , Turkey .
Summary
Establishing trimester-specific D-dimer reference intervals in pregnant patients is crucial for accurate venous thromboembolism diagnosis. These new ranges help avoid misinterpretation common with general population thresholds.
Area of Science:
- Obstetrics and Gynecology
- Hematology
- Clinical Chemistry
Background:
- D-dimer testing is essential for diagnosing venous thromboembolism (VTE) in pregnant patients.
- Standard D-dimer reference intervals can lead to misinterpretation during pregnancy.
- Accurate diagnostic thresholds are needed for VTE evaluation in pregnant individuals.
Purpose of the Study:
- To determine trimester-specific reference intervals for D-dimer in pregnant women.
- To compare these intervals with those used for the general population.
Main Methods:
- A cross-sectional study involving 416 pregnant women and 32 non-pregnant women.
- Participants were categorized into first (5-11 weeks), second (13-20 weeks), and third (25-35 weeks) trimesters.
- D-dimer levels were quantified using an immunoturbidimetric assay.
Main Results:
- Using a 0.50 mg/L threshold, 4.8% of second-trimester and 23.8% of third-trimester pregnant women exceeded the value.
- Established D-dimer reference intervals were: 0.11-0.40 mg/L (first trimester), 0.14-0.75 mg/L (second trimester), and 0.16-1.3 mg/L (third trimester).
Conclusions:
- Trimester-specific D-dimer reference intervals differ significantly from general population values.
- These established intervals can aid clinicians in accurate VTE diagnosis during pregnancy.
- Further research is recommended to establish new D-dimer cut-off values for VTE exclusion in each trimester.
